Description

 

Much has changed since our early days as floor traders at the Amsterdam Stock Exchange. Today, Optiver leverages technology to solve a variety of complex problems: optimising for scarce bandwidth, responding to market events with nanosecond speed, automatically pricing complex sets of financial instruments with extremely low error tolerance, and analysing huge volumes of data. Our systems are built to add to the stability of the market, not detract from it; therefore they must operate at peak efficiency in the most extreme market conditions. To achieve this, our user interfaces must present coherent, responsive, real-time visualisations of market activity and system performance while providing intuitive control of a highly complex system. WHO WE ARE:

Optiver is a tech-driven trading firm and leading global market maker. As one of the oldest market making institutions, we are a trusted partner of 50+ exchanges across the globe. Our mission is to constantly improve the market by injecting liquidity, providing accurate pricing, increasing transparency and acting as a stabilising force no matter the market conditions. With a focus on continuous improvement, we participate in the safeguarding of healthy and efficient markets for everyone who participates.

Our Amsterdam office is where it all began. Over 35 years ago, Optiver’s business started with a single trader on the floor of Amsterdam’s European Stock Exchange. Since our 1986 founding, Optiver’s Amsterdam office has grown into one of the most dynamic and exciting trading floors in Europe. Our culture reflects the Dutch capital city’s progressive, innovative and inclusive nature. With its unique spirit, Amsterdam is the ideal hub for our teams to trade a wide range of products from listed derivatives to cash equities, ETFs, bonds and foreign exchange. 

 

WHAT YOU'LL DO:

As part of our Trading Technology Team, you'll be responsible for the full stack of applications required to run the trading business. Activities range from developing ultra-low-latency exchange protocol encoders and decoders, writing and fine-tuning our automated trading strategies, to helping our monitoring and analysis effort by creating and extending user interfaces to provide the Traders with more information and control. You'll interact closely with Traders and Researchers to understand the business needs and design effective solutions.
